A chain bridge, also known as a cross-chain bridge, is essentially a tool that allows the transfer of tokens or data between different blockchains. Think of it like a bridge connecting two different islands. Without the bridge, you'd be stuck on your island, unable to access the resources or opportunities on the other island. In the crypto world, these islands are the various blockchains, such as Ethereum, Binance Smart Chain, and, of course, the PSEIUNIONSE chain. PSEIUNIONSE acts as a bridge, enabling seamless movement of crypto assets between these otherwise isolated blockchain ecosystems. This interoperability is crucial because it allows users to access a wider range of decentralized applications (dApps), trading opportunities, and overall flexibility within the crypto landscape.     Decoding the PSEIUNIONSE Chain Bridge

    Alright, let's get into the nitty-gritty of how the PSEIUNIONSE chain bridge actually works. At its core, it employs a combination of smart contracts and decentralized protocols to facilitate cross-chain transactions. When you initiate a transaction to move tokens from one blockchain to the PSEIUNIONSE chain, the bridge locks those tokens on the source chain. Concurrently, it mints an equivalent amount of wrapped tokens on the destination chain, in this case, the PSEIUNIONSE chain. These wrapped tokens represent the original tokens but are compatible with the destination chain's standards. This process ensures that the total supply of the original tokens remains unchanged. This method prevents the creation of duplicate tokens, maintaining the integrity of the underlying assets. Furthermore, the bridge often utilizes a network of validators or oracles to verify the transaction's legitimacy and security. These validators monitor the activity on both chains and confirm the movement of tokens. This validation process adds another layer of security, reducing the risk of malicious activities.     Security Aspects of the PSEIUNIONSE Chain Bridge

    Now, let's talk security. The PSEIUNIONSE chain bridge, like any technology that handles digital assets, must have robust security measures to protect user funds. Here's a look at the security features and best practices associated with these bridges. Smart contracts are at the heart of most chain bridges. These contracts govern the movement of tokens and other assets. Security audits are critical. Independent security firms should regularly audit the smart contracts to identify and fix any vulnerabilities. This process involves a thorough review of the code to ensure it functions correctly and is free from exploits. Bridges often employ a decentralized network of validators. These validators verify transactions and secure the bridge. Choosing a bridge with a well-established and reputable validator network is crucial. Decentralization reduces the risk of a single point of failure. The PSEIUNIONSE chain bridge also implements encryption techniques to protect data during transmission. This ensures that sensitive information, such as transaction details, remains confidential and secure. Users should always be aware of potential risks. Bridges can be vulnerable to attacks, such as hacking or exploits in smart contracts. Therefore, it's essential to exercise caution and thoroughly research any bridge before using it. You should always use reputable bridges that have a strong track record and robust security measures. Additionally, it is essential to stay up-to-date with the latest security advisories and updates from the bridge's developers.
